Course Content

• Cloud Computing Law Fundamentals
• Data Privacy and Security in the Cloud (GDPR, CCPA, etc.)
• Contract Law for Cloud Services Agreements
• Cloud Infrastructure Security Compliance (ISO 27001, SOC 2)
• Intellectual Property Rights in the Cloud
• Cybersecurity and Cloud Computing Risk Management
• Cross-border Data Transfers and Cloud Compliance
• Online Cloud Computing Laws and Forensics

Career path

Job Role (Cloud Computing Laws UK) Description
Certified Cloud Compliance Specialist Ensures adherence to data protection regulations (GDPR, CCPA) in cloud environments. High demand due to increasing regulatory scrutiny.
Cloud Security Architect (Online Laws) Designs and implements secure cloud architectures, mitigating legal and compliance risks. Critical role in online security and data privacy.
Legal Tech Consultant (Cloud Computing) Advises clients on legal implications of cloud adoption, specializing in online contracts and data governance. Growing field with strong future prospects.
Data Privacy Officer (Cloud Focus) Responsible for data protection in cloud-based systems, ensuring compliance with international and UK data privacy laws. Essential for large organizations.
